Personal Energy at Work: A Systematic Review

A. F. J. Klijn, M. Tims, et al.

A two-fold systematic review defines personal energy at work and introduces a theoretical framework that explains why—given similar work—some employees feel energized while others do not, highlighting employer context, personal characteristics, and strain and recovery processes. Research was conducted by Alexandra Francina Janneke Klijn, Maria Tims, Evgenia I. Lysova, and Svetlana N. Khapova.... show more
